Is MetaMask Safe? Pros, Cons & Security Tips

Introduction

\"\"

Hey there, crypto friends! If you\’ve been in the blockchain space for more than five minutes, you\’ve probably heard of MetaMask. That little fox icon has become as familiar as your morning coffee for many of us diving into the world of DeFi, NFTs, and all things Ethereum. But with crypto scams making headlines every other day, I often get asked: \”Is MetaMask actually safe to use?\”

It\’s a fair question! After all, we\’re talking about your hard-earned money here. I\’ve been using MetaMask for years now (with a few heart-stopping moments along the way), so I thought I\’d share what I\’ve learned about keeping your digital assets secure while using this popular wallet.

What is MetaMask, Anyway?

For the newbies in the room, let me break it down quickly. MetaMaskhttps://metamask.io/ is essentially a digital wallet that lives in your browser as an extension (or on your phone as an app). Think of it as your passport to the Ethereum ecosystem – it holds your ETH and any ERC-20 tokens (those are tokens built on the Ethereum blockchain), and it lets you interact with decentralized applications (dApps).

The beauty of MetaMask is that it bridges the gap between your regular web browser and the Ethereum blockchain. Want to swap some tokens on Uniswap? Buy an NFT on OpenSea? Stake some coins for yield farming? MetaMask is your ticket to all of that without needing to be a coding wizard.

I remember when I first installed it back in 2018 – suddenly, this whole new internet opened up to me. It was like finding a secret door in a house I thought I knew completely!

How Does MetaMask Actually Work?

Alright, let\’s peek under the hood without getting too technical. MetaMask operates using two crucial elements:

Private Keys & Your Wallet

Your MetaMask wallet has a unique private key – essentially a super-complicated password that proves you own your crypto assets. MetaMask handles this private key for you, so you don\’t need to worry about the technical stuff. When you want to send tokens or interact with a dApp, MetaMask uses this private key to \”sign\” the transaction, verifying that you\’re the rightful owner.

Seed Phrases (The Holy Grail)

When you first set up MetaMask, it gives you a 12-word \”seed phrase\” (sometimes called a recovery phrase). These random words might seem silly, but they\’re EVERYTHING. This phrase is basically the master key to your wallet – anyone who has these words can access and control your funds.

I keep mine written on paper, locked in a fireproof safe – not even joking! I\’ve heard horror stories of people keeping their seed phrase in a text file named \”CRYPTO PASSWORDS\” and then wondering how they got hacked. Don\’t be that person!

Connecting to dApps

One of MetaMask\’s superpowers is how it lets you connect to decentralized applications with a couple of clicks. When you visit a dApp like Uniswap or OpenSea, you\’ll see a \”Connect Wallet\” button. Click it, choose MetaMask, and boom – you\’re in! The dApp can now see your Ethereum address (but not your private key) and request permission to make transactions, which you\’ll need to approve.

The Big Question: Is MetaMask Actually Safe?

After years of using it, my honest answer is: MetaMask is as safe as you make it. The wallet itself has solid security foundations, but like leaving your house keys under the welcome mat, poor security practices can undermine even the best systems.

Built-in Security Features

MetaMask comes with several layers of protection:

Password Protection: In order to access your wallet whenever you wish to use it, you will need to set a password. This is your first line of defense against someone who might have physical access to your device.

Seed Phrase: As I mentioned earlier, this 12-word phrase is crucial for recovery and security. MetaMask never stores this phrase on their servers – it\’s entirely your responsibility to keep it safe.

Optional Hardware Wallet Integration: For next-level security, MetaMask can connect with hardware wallets like Ledger or Trezor. I started doing this after my portfolio grew beyond what I was comfortable risking, and honestly, the peace of mind is worth every penny.

The Open-Source Advantage

One thing I love about MetaMask is that it\’s open-source software. This means anyone can review the code for vulnerabilities or backdoors. Thousands of eagle-eyed developers have picked through MetaMask\’s code, which makes it harder (though not impossible) for security flaws to remain undiscovered.

That said, being open-source does mean that potential attackers can also study the code for weaknesses. It\’s a double-edged sword, but generally considered a security positive in the crypto community.

The Good Stuff: Pros of Using MetaMask

User-Friendly Interface

For something that interacts with complicated blockchain technology, MetaMask is surprisingly easy to use. The interface is clean and intuitive – even my tech-challenged friend who still prints out emails managed to figure it out after a quick tutorial.

Plays Nice With Most dApps

MetaMask is the Swiss Army knife of Ethereum wallets when it comes to compatibility. Almost every major dApp supports MetaMask integration. This universal acceptance means you\’re rarely left out in the cold when exploring new projects.

Available Everywhere You Need It

Whether you\’re browsing on Chrome, Firefox, Brave, or Edge, MetaMask has you covered with its browser extension. They\’ve also launched a mobile app that syncs with your browser wallet, so you can take your crypto on the go.

No Upfront Cost

MetaMask is free to download and use. They make money through their swap feature, where they take a small fee for token exchanges, but using the basic wallet functionality doesn\’t cost you anything (except network gas fees, but that\’s an Ethereum thing, not a MetaMask thing).

The Not-So-Good: Cons of Using MetaMask

Security Risks to Know About

Attacks by Phishing: There are some really plausible scams out there! Emails purporting to be from \”MetaMask Support\” have been sent to me requesting that I \”verify my wallet\” by inputting my seed phrase. Keep in mind that nobody, not even the official MetaMask team, will ask for your seed phrase.

Browser-Based Vulnerabilities: Compared to cold storage solutions like hardware wallets, MetaMask is potentially more vulnerable because it runs within your browser. Your MetaMask may be at danger if your browser is compromised.

No Native Two-Factor Authentication

This is a big one. Most financial applications now offer two-factor authentication (2FA) where you need your password plus a code from your phone. MetaMask relies solely on your password for the browser extension. This means if someone gets your password, they potentially have access to your funds.

Human Error: The Biggest Risk

Let\’s be honest:https://blockchainnetwork.site/fake-crypto-exchanges-you-shouldnt-ignore/ the biggest security threat to your crypto isn\’t sophisticated hackers – it\’s you accidentally doing something wrong. Sending tokens to the wrong address, connecting to a scam website, or downloading a fake MetaMask extension happens more often than people admit.

I once nearly sent 2 ETH to a scammer because I was in a hurry and didn\’t double-check the address. A last-second gut feeling made me verify, and I\’m so glad I did!

How to Keep Your MetaMask Fortress Secure

After some close calls and learning from others\’ mistakes, here are my top security tips:

1. Create an Unpredictable Password

Don\’t use your cat\’s name followed by your birth year (looking at you, Fluffy2001!). Use a random mix of uppercase, lowercase, numbers, and symbols. Consider a password manager to generate and store a truly random password.

2. Protect Your Seed Phrase Like It\’s the Nuclear Launch Codes

  • Write it down on paper (multiple copies)
  • Store in secure locations (fireproof safe, safety deposit box)
  • NEVER store it digitally (no photos, no cloud docs, no password managers)
  • Consider metal backup solutions for fire/water resistance

I split my seed phrase into two parts and store them in different locations. Overkill? Maybe. But I sleep better at night.

3. Add a Hardware Wallet Layer

Connect MetaMask to a hardware wallet such as Trezor or Ledger if you are a serious cryptocurrency owner. This way, even if someone gains access to your MetaMask, they\’d still need physical access to your hardware wallet to approve transactions.

4. Become a Phishing Detection Expert

  • Always check the URL (metamask.io is real, metamask.net is probably fake)
  • Install trusted browser security extensions
  • Never click crypto links in emails or DMs
  • Type URLs directly or use bookmarks

5. Create a Separate Browser Profile for Crypto

I have a dedicated browser profile that I use only for crypto – no other browsing, no other extensions. This dramatically reduces the risk of malicious extensions or websites gaining access to my MetaMask.

6. Consider Multiple Wallets

Don\’t keep all your crypto in one wallet. I have a \”trading\” MetaMask with smaller amounts for active use, and separate wallets for long-term holdings. Consider it similar to having a savings account and a checking account.

What About the Alternatives?

For everyday Ethereum interactions, MetaMask is my preferred tool, however depending on your needs, you might want to look at other options:

Hardware Wallets: Maximum Security

The well-known brands here are Trezor and Ledger. They are practically impervious to online attacks since they keep your private keys offline on a tangible device. I use my Ledger for long-term holdings and connect it to MetaMask for extra security when making large transactions.

The downside? They cost money ($60-150) and add an extra step to transactions. Worth it for serious investors, perhaps overkill for small holdings.

Other Software Wallets

Trust Wallet: Great mobile option with support for multiple blockchains.
Coinbase Wallet: User-friendly and backed by a major exchange.
Exodus: Beautiful interface with built-in exchange features.

These offer different features and security models, but similar convenience to MetaMask.

Leave a Reply

Your email address will not be published. Required fields are marked *